我们提供招生管理系统招投标所需全套资料,包括招生系统介绍PPT、招生管理系统产品解决方案、
招生管理系统产品技术参数,以及对应的标书参考文件,详请联系客服。
哎,说到这个“招生系统”,大家是不是经常听到这个词?尤其是咱们唐山这边,很多学校、培训机构都在考虑搞个自己的招生系统。不过,你有没有想过,这玩意儿到底要花多少钱?今天我就来跟大家唠一唠,从技术的角度,说说这个“多少钱”的事儿。
首先,我得先说清楚,什么是招生系统。简单来说,就是一个能帮助学校或者机构管理学生信息、报名流程、课程安排、缴费记录等等的软件系统。它可能是一个网站,也可能是一个App,甚至是一个小程序。但不管是什么形式,核心功能就是让招生工作更高效、更透明。
那么问题来了,开发这样一个系统,要花多少钱呢?这个问题,其实没有一个标准答案。因为这取决于很多因素,比如系统的复杂度、功能需求、开发团队的水平、使用的技术栈等等。而且,不同的地方,价格也不一样。比如说,在唐山,如果你找本地的开发公司,可能比在北上广深便宜一些,但也有可能贵一些,这要看具体情况。
我们先来聊点技术方面的东西。假设你要做一个简单的招生系统,那用什么语言好呢?现在主流的前端语言有HTML、CSS、JavaScript,后端的话,常见的有Python(Django/Flask)、Java(Spring Boot)、PHP(Laravel)等等。数据库的话,MySQL、PostgreSQL、MongoDB都是常用的选择。
下面我来举个例子,写一段简单的代码,展示一下一个基本的招生系统是怎么工作的。当然,这只是最基础的版本,不涉及复杂的业务逻辑,只是为了让大家有个直观的理解。
比如,我们用Python的Flask框架来搭建一个简单的网页,用户可以填写报名信息,然后提交到数据库里。这里我写一个简单的示例代码:
from flask import Flask, render_template, request, redirect, url_for
from flask_sqlalchemy import SQLAlchemy
app = Flask(__name__)
app.config['SQLALCHEMY_DATABASE_URI'] = 'sqlite:///students.db'
db = SQLAlchemy(app)
class Student(db.Model):
id = db.Column(db.Integer, primary_key=True)
name = db.Column(db.String(100), nullable=False)
email = db.Column(db.String(120), unique=True, nullable=False)
phone = db.Column(db.String(20), nullable=False)
@app.route('/', methods=['GET', 'POST'])
def index():
if request.method == 'POST':
name = request.form['name']
email = request.form['email']
phone = request.form['phone']
new_student = Student(name=name, email=email, phone=phone)
db.session.add(new_student)
db.session.commit()
return redirect(url_for('success'))
return render_template('index.html')
@app.route('/success')
def success():
return "报名成功!感谢您的参与。"
if __name__ == '__main__':
with app.app_context():
db.create_all()
app.run(debug=True)
这段代码用的是Flask框架,创建了一个简单的注册页面,用户填写姓名、邮箱、电话,然后提交到数据库里。看起来是不是挺简单的?不过,这只是最基础的版本。如果要实现更多的功能,比如支付、课程选择、权限管理、数据统计等等,那代码就会变得复杂很多。
现在回到“多少钱”的问题。如果只是做一个这样的基础系统,大概需要多少钱呢?在唐山,如果是找本地的开发团队,可能需要3万到5万左右。不过,这个价格也取决于开发团队的水平和项目的复杂程度。如果是一些小作坊,可能价格会低一些,但风险也大;如果是一些正规的公司,价格高一些,但质量更有保障。
但是,如果你想要一个更高级的系统,比如支持多校区、多课程、在线支付、微信公众号对接、数据分析等功能,那价格就会上涨。这时候,可能就需要10万以上了。甚至有的高端定制系统,价格能高达几十万。这可不是开玩笑的,因为这些系统需要大量的时间去开发、测试、部署和维护。
所以,为什么会有这么大的价格差异?原因很简单,就是功能越多、技术越复杂,开发的成本就越高。比如,如果你要用到微服务架构,或者需要与第三方平台(比如支付宝、微信支付)进行对接,那开发难度和时间都会增加,自然价格也会更高。
另外,还有一个重要因素是开发人员的工资。在唐山,程序员的薪资水平虽然比不上北京、上海,但也不能小看。一个经验丰富的全栈工程师,一个月的工资可能在1.5万到2万之间。如果一个项目需要两个人做三个月,那光人力成本就已经是9万到12万了。再加上服务器、域名、设计、测试等其他费用,总成本就更高了。
所以,如果你在唐山,打算开发一个招生系统,一定要提前做好预算规划。别以为随便找个程序员就能搞定,还得考虑后续的维护、升级和安全性等问题。
再说说技术实现的问题。现在很多学校和机构都希望系统能支持移动端,所以现在的招生系统大多采用响应式设计,或者直接做成小程序。比如,用微信小程序来做招生系统,这样用户可以直接在微信里操作,不用下载App,体验更好。
要做小程序的话,前端可以用Vue.js、React Native,后端可以用Node.js或者PHP。数据库的话,还是MySQL或者MongoDB比较常见。不过,如果是做小程序,可能还需要接入微信的API,比如获取用户信息、支付接口等等。这部分内容也比较复杂,需要有一定的开发经验。
如果你是第一次接触这类系统,建议找一个靠谱的开发团队,不要自己盲目尝试。毕竟,系统一旦上线,就要长期运行,出一点问题就会影响招生效果,甚至可能影响学校的声誉。
另外,还有一点需要注意,就是系统的安全性和数据隐私。招生系统涉及到很多用户的个人信息,比如姓名、电话、身份证号、地址等等,这些数据一旦泄露,后果非常严重。所以,开发过程中必须做好数据加密、权限控制、备份机制等工作。
总结一下,开发一个招生系统,要花多少钱,主要看以下几个方面:
1. 功能需求:功能越多,价格越高。
2. 技术选型:不同的技术栈,开发成本不同。
3. 开发团队:团队的经验和水平直接影响价格。

4. 后期维护:是否包含后期的维护和更新服务。
在唐山,如果你想做一个中等规模的招生系统,大概需要5万到15万之间。如果是高端定制,可能要超过20万。不过,这些价格仅供参考,具体还要看实际情况。
最后,我想说的是,虽然“多少钱”是一个很现实的问题,但也不能只看价格。毕竟,一个好的系统,不仅要看价格,还要看它的稳定性、可扩展性、用户体验和售后服务。所以,如果你真的打算开发一个招生系统,建议多对比几家,多了解一些技术细节,再做决定。

好了,今天的分享就到这里。希望这篇文章能帮到你,也希望大家在开发系统的时候,都能找到性价比高的解决方案。